Basically, you would store the data in an AttributeDcitionary onto the garage component.

When the user needs to edit the data, you convert the dictionary to a Ruby Hash instance, then convert it to a JSON Object string and pass it to the dialog. A JS function can then stuff the values from the JS Object into your edit fields.

After the changes are made, the reverse is done. Ie, the JS Object is updated from the values on the form, and the JS Object is passed back to Ruby which automatically converts it back to a Ruby Hash. This hash can then be used to update the attribute dictionary attached to the garage instance in the model using:

data_hash.each { |key, val| data_dict[key.to_s]= val }
